A very light, monoline italic sans with rounded construction and a consistently soft stroke ending. Curves are smooth and slightly squarish where they transition into straights, giving bowls and rounds a clean, controlled feel rather than a calligraphic one. Apertures and counters stay open, and spacing feels even, producing a quiet, legible rhythm in continuous text. The italics are driven by a steady oblique slant with minimal stroke modulation, keeping the overall texture crisp and uncluttered.

The numeral set follows the same light, rounded logic, and the overall character set maintains a coherent geometry across straight and curved strokes. In text, the light weight creates a delicate color, so it benefits from ample size or generous contrast against the background.
